Burnaby crime in 2025

In 2025, Burnaby, British Columbia recorded 2,336 total police incidents in the open dataset. Theft from vehicle was the primary category, accounting for 1,350 incidents. Break and enter represented the second highest category with 744 reported incidents, followed by auto theft with 242 incidents. The 2025 total represents 67.3% of the 3,470 total incidents recorded across all years in the city's archive.

What these numbers mean

Burnaby's 2025 open-data profile is defined by property and vehicle incidents, with theft from vehicle reaching 1,350 cases and break and enter logging 744 cases. Auto theft added 242 cases to the annual total. Ranking first out of two recorded years, 2025 generated 2,336 incidents compared to 1,134 in 2026, holding 67.3 percent of the city's 3,470 total archived incidents. The concentration of vehicle-related thefts stands out as the prominent feature in Burnaby's initial archived year.
